These changes increase the rigidity of the AT, and it is hypothesized that fibrosis limits the ability of individual adipocytes to swell and store additional dietary lipid (9, 18, 32) or to shrink during weight loss (24). In addition to fat storage, subcutaneous AT provides thermal insulation and acts as a shock absorber, providing padding at various anatomic sites (2, 20), whereas omental AT is one of the visceral AT depots, surrounding the intestines superficially (41) and among other things cushioning and protecting inner organs from physical injury (40). It has been suggested that the inability to store dietary lipid in adipocytes could result in its deposition as ectopic fat around the heart, muscle, and liver, predisposing an individual to obesity-related health problems (3, 27, 39). Minor depots include the pericardial, which surrounds the heart, and the paired popliteal depots, between the major muscles behind the knees, each containing one large lymph node. The net direction of this flux is controlled by insulin and leptin—if insulin is elevated, then there is a net inward flux of FFA, and only when insulin is low can FFA leave adipose tissue.
